This is a mid-19th-century orchestral work by Hungarian composer Franz Liszt, composed in the 1850s. It employs programme-driven structures, advanced chromatic harmony and expansive orchestral colours, and represents a key moment in Liszt's move towards the symphonic poem and the broader development of programme-oriented orchestral music in the nineteenth century.
